PINSON, Ala. (WIAT) — A severe storm that swept through Pinson Thursday night left trees on top of homes, downed power lines, and neighbors helping one another in the wake of the devastation.
Center Point Fire Chief Brandon Dahlen said crews received calls for assistance in the area around 3:30 p.m. Thursday.
“It was something we weren’t expecting initially on the dispatch,” Dahlen said. “Once our crews arrived, we realized it was actually more severe than that. It appears a storm system of some type has come through with multiple trees down, several structures that were damaged, ranging anywhere from just minor damage to structure to actual trees through homes and complete destruction.”…
